Solution for 8x=15-3(2x+3) equation:


Simplifying
8x = 15 + -3(2x + 3)

Reorder the terms:
8x = 15 + -3(3 + 2x)
8x = 15 + (3 * -3 + 2x * -3)
8x = 15 + (-9 + -6x)

Combine like terms: 15 + -9 = 6
8x = 6 + -6x

Solving
8x = 6 + -6x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'6x' to each side of the equation.
8x + 6x = 6 + -6x + 6x

Combine like terms: 8x + 6x = 14x
14x = 6 + -6x + 6x

Combine like terms: -6x + 6x = 0
14x = 6 + 0
14x = 6

Divide each side by '14'.
x = 0.4285714286

Simplifying
x = 0.4285714286
